Life is full of care, there is no time to stand and stare. A friend once told me, it will only get busier and crazier. You will never find all the lights to be green. There will definitely be reds along the way. But that should not scare you. Start driving and the reds will turn into green eventually. Along the way, discover pockets of happiness. Small, little pockets which are all around you. You just need to look in their direction and make sure they do not go ignored. They are small but they pack a helluva lot of punch.
So I am sitting here thinking about those pockets. Trying to jot a few of them down so I can come back to them when the world seems a bit too dreary.
1. Baking a cake and sticking a knife into it…Voila!…the knife comes out clean and the Vanilla overpowers your senses.Heaven!
2. Checking the pockets of your dirty jeans before laundry and discovering an old forgotten 20 rupee note.
3. Getting a text/call when you are least expecting it only to be told that you are loved,cherished and you are awesome in some little way. Smiles,smiles smiles
4. Spending a fun evening with somebody when you were actually dreading a boring conversation.
5. Burning 50 extra calories, pushing yourself just a tad bit more and finding your tee drenched in sweat. Awesome!!!
6. Changing a fused bulb and switching it on to see the room fill up with light. Sheer genius!
7. Window shopping only to discover a super cute find for 15 bucks.What a wave of happiness!
8. Lying in bed thinking about happy times and smiling all to yourself like a fool.
9. Driving back home on a Friday evening…yipeeeeeee!
10. Having a long conversation with mom full of inconsequential details and useless garbage.
11. Predicting the lines of a character in a movie exactly 5 seconds before he speaks the exact same thing. Makes you feel like you can write blockbuster movies with the sleight of your hand!
The list is seemingly endless and isn’t that a really,really good thing?
